This is a front-end for the Online Encyclopedia of Integer Sequences, made by Christian Perfect. The idea is to provide OEIS entries in non-ancient HTML, and then to think about how they're presented visually. The source code is on GitHub.
%I A168443 #13 Apr 14 2022 07:23:10 %S A168443 1,1,1,1,2,1,1,2,3,1,1,3,4,4,1,1,3,6,7,5,1,1,4,7,11,11,6,1,1,4,9,15, %T A168443 19,16,7,1,1,5,11,19,29,31,22,8,1,1,5,13,25,39,52,48,29,9,1,1,6,15,30, %U A168443 53,76,88,71,37,10,1,1,6,18,37,67,107,140,142,101,46,11,1,1,7,20,44,84,143,207,245,220,139,56,12,1 %N A168443 Triangle, T(n,k) = number of compositions a(1),...,a(k) of n, such that a(i+1) <= a(i) + 1 for 1 <= i < k. %H A168443 Alois P. Heinz, <a href="/A168443/b168443.txt">Rows n = 1..200, flattened</a> %e A168443 Triangle T(n,k) begins: %e A168443 1; %e A168443 1, 1; %e A168443 1, 2, 1; %e A168443 1, 2, 3, 1; %e A168443 1, 3, 4, 4, 1; %e A168443 1, 3, 6, 7, 5, 1; %e A168443 1, 4, 7, 11, 11, 6, 1; %e A168443 1, 4, 9, 15, 19, 16, 7, 1; %e A168443 ... %p A168443 b:= proc(n, k) option remember; expand(`if`(n=0, 1, %p A168443 x*add(b(n-j, j), j=1..min(n, k+1)))) %p A168443 end: %p A168443 T:= n-> (p-> seq(coeff(p, x, i), i=1..n))(b(n$2)): %p A168443 seq(T(n), n=1..14); # _Alois P. Heinz_, Jan 21 2022 %t A168443 b[n_, k_] := b[n, k] = Expand[If[n == 0, 1, %t A168443 x*Sum[b[n - j, j], {j, 1, Min[n, k + 1]}]]]; %t A168443 T[n_] := Rest@CoefficientList[b[n, n], x]; %t A168443 Table[T[n], {n, 1, 14}] // Flatten (* _Jean-François Alcover_, Apr 14 2022, after _Alois P. Heinz_ *) %Y A168443 Cf. A003116 (row sums), A168396. %K A168443 nonn,tabl %O A168443 1,5 %A A168443 _Vladeta Jovovic_, Nov 25 2009